How Dubai changed the life of a British property agent

Dubai: A British expat, who specialises in selling luxury properties in Palm Jumeirah and Emirate Hills, says there is no place quite like Dubai when it comes to being a realtor - despite him foraying into the business during the global downturn.

Barnaby Crompton, better known as Barney, relocated to Dubai from London in 2008 when the world was reeling under recession. But ironically, as the 42 year old told Gulf News, it was the real estate sector that brought him to Dubai that very year.

“I was an estate agent from the age of 17. And the recession in the UK had been going on for about six months. When I looked elsewhere in the world to find a market that was doing well, Dubai came up as the only real estate market that was bucking the trend at the time, so I moved here in September 2008,” he said.

The phone stopped ringing

Barney recalls how the phone stopped ringing soon after. “I was assured by colleagues that the phones would start ringing again and it was totally normal, but the phones didn’t really start ringing again for another nine months. In the interim, I managed to sell four properties before Ramadan
